Producer Mike Dean Confirms ‘Watch The Throne’ Sequel, Talks “Intense” Studio Sessions With Kanye

Serial Kanye West collaborator and studio dweller Mike Dean has given some rare insight into what goes down within the closed doors on Ye’s recording sessions. In a recent interview, Dean detailed the “intense” production process that ultimately led to the creation of Yeezus, and also said that a follow-up to the hugely successful Watch The Throne is on the cards.

Speaking with HuffPost Live, Dean described his partner in crime as a “couch producer”, explaining that West employs the expertise of a team of top-tier producers, all of whom throw their two cents into the mix for each track, leaving him and Dean to pick the best options:

“”It’s sort of a checks and balances for both of us… We have a dozen people working with us in the studio, we all do quality control. It’s the most intense production project you’ll ever see… It’s so many A-List people who would never work together unless Kanye put them together.”



Even though the due date of Tuesday, 18th June is very quickly approaching, West is still meddling with his new creation but will still be committing to the deadline. Once it drops, fans shouldn’t be expecting a continuation from My Beautiful Dark Twisted Fantasy, but rather “a new work of art.”

However, fans can expect a continuation of West’s work with Jay-Z. Just last week Dean spoke to the other half of Watch The Throne confirming that a sequel is currently in the pipeline. Check out the full interview below.
